The course explores the ethical environment in which the agent works. In the insurance industry, regulators dominate this environment. This course looks at the most important functions of the regulators and key regulations to which the agent must adhere. This course examines the following: history of insurance regulation, state regulation and other regulatory influences, regulations concerning rebating, unfair discrimination, false advertising, unfair claims settlement and finally federal regulations affecting insurance agents, including several new privacy laws passed by Congress.
